| align="center"| '''''New Hope'''''[[File:NewHope.png|150px|thumb|center|New Hope]] || This light reconnaissance vehicle was based on the Fang unit, the pride of the LC. The New Hope isn't quite as powerful as its predecessor, but it has still managed to prove its value in some tight spots. Its ability to repair itself is particularly impressive. Even after suffering extreme damage to its epoxy armor, New Hope needs only a few seconds to become fully battle-ready again. This unique feature is the result of a complex fiberglass pressing and hardening system. However, the unit has one fairly large disadvantage: there is no facility for mounting shields stronger than 1000 PSU. New Hope is a support unit. Used wisely, it can have a decisive effect on your entire offensive. But you'll need to develop an elastic strike-and-retreat strategy.

| align="center"| '''''Fat Girl'''''[[File:FatgM3.png|150px|thumb|center|Fat Girl]] || This is a mobile container, driven by a strong fragmentation motor which has been adapted from that previously used only be orbiting stations. The maximum lifting capacity is 3600 tons. Maximum speed is 18 km/h. Thanks to her strong engine, '''you can mount up to 4 light guns''' of any type. This makes Fat Girl an unbelievably effective frontline unit. Though its production time summed with every weapon mounted on results in a very long waiting span. That's why it is recommended to mount '''machine guns''' on instead of other, more sophisticated (like rockets and electro cannons) weapons which would significantly increase production time. (Of course, this does not apply if you have unlimited time to prepare your units and enemy will surely wait for you to catch up)

| align="center"| '''''Crater'''''[[File:CraterM3.png|150px|thumb|center|Crater m3]] || When designing this vehicle, the LC engineers sacrificed speed for power, and equipped it with heavy armor and a power shield generator. The decision made Crater the most resistant of all LC units. And it's been '''adapted to carry high-caliber weapons''' that should guarantee its success in the heat of battle. Even if this is the most armored and sustaining troop amongst Lunar Corporation vehicles, it's still the weakest in comparison with the other factions heavy armored units.

| align="center"| '''''Crusher'''''[[File:CrusherM3.png|150px|thumb|center|Crusher m3]] || This typical attack vehicle is designed to inflict huge losses on the enemy in a very short period of time. The engineers have made it '''possible to attach two heavy weapon systems'''. Crusher is unable to spend a long time under direct fire. It need to be protected with an escort of other units, taking enemy fire at themselves.

| align="center"| '''''Crion'''''[[File:Crion.png|150px|thumb|center|Crion]] || Mobile artillery unit. It usually carries long range plasma cannon that launches dense projectile which ignores target power shields. Very long range of this unit is paid for by a very slow movement speed and lack of any armor. It's better to keep Crions out of enemy weapon range. It can have mounted plasma artillery cannon or Anti-air rocket launcher.
